![]() ![]() The simple way to do this is using the following command. This will be used to store the files which can be transferred to RPI.Ĭhange the IP address of your Ubuntu system Ethernet interface IP address to the serverip address. The default directory can be either /srv/tftp or /var/lib/tftpboot. Typically the files are a kernel and initrd image. Please use this tutorial to install TFTP server in your development system (Ubuntu). The client downloads files via TFTP from the host specified in the next-server field of the lease. The environment variable saveenv saves the environment data to the SD card so that you don’t have to enter this data every time the board boots. ![]() ![]() This can be any system as long as it is in the same network as Raspberry Pi. I am using my development system as a TFTP server. The serverip environment variable is system IP address in which TFTP server is running. The environment variable ipaddr is the IP address of the Raspberry Pi. Setenv serverip 192.168.1.15 # IP address of host system ethernet interface In the console, run the following commands. Power up the Raspberry Pi, press Enter to login to U-boot console immediately after powerup. From the TFTP server (assuming Linux, in this case Raspberry Pi) install. Both Raspberry PI and the host system should belong to same network to be able to communicate. I am attempting to get TFTP working using DNSMASQ on a Raspberry Pi host so. TFTP communication with Raspberry Pi 3 Model B Setup the U-bootĬonnect Rapberry PI to the Ubuntu system using Ethernet cable. In the upcoming articles, we will be using this method to download Linux kernel and Device tree from the TFTP server to the Rapsberry Pi. After establishing TFTP communication, the U-boot will be able to download the files from TFTP server and load into the RAM. The development system acts like TFTP server and used to host the files which can be transferred to the RPI. In this article we will see how to establish TFTP protocol communication between development system and RPI. In the earlier post, we saw the boot process of Raspberry Pi 3 Model B and how to login to U-boot console. Please check earlier articles to get the grasp of current one. ![]() This is part 4 of the series Embedded Linux with Raspberry Pi 3 Model B.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|